Kits SDK Event Grid de gestion et de publication
Event Grid fournit des Kits de développement logiciel (SDK) qui permettent de gérer ses ressources et de publier (POST) des événements par programme.
Remarque
Concernant la dépréciation de TLS 1.0 / 1.1: pour les rubriques système, vous devez prendre des mesures uniquement pour la remise d’événements aux destinations webhook. Si la destination prend en charge TLS 1.2, la remise des événements se produit à l’aide de la version 1.2. Si la destination ne prend pas en charge TLS 1.2, la remise des événements revient automatiquement à 1.0 et 1.1. Après le 1er mars 2025, la livraison d’événements utilisant les versions 1.0 et 1.1 ne sera plus prise en charge. Vérifiez que vos destinations de webhook prennent en charge TLS 1.2. Un moyen simple de vérifier la prise en charge de TLS 1.2 consiste à utiliser Qualys SSL Labs. Si le rapport indique que TLS 1.2 est pris en charge, aucune action n’est requise. Pour plus d’informations, consultez le billet de blog suivant : Mise hors service : Modifications TLS à venir pour Azure Event Grid
Kits SDK de gestion
Les kits de développement logiciel (SDK) de gestion permettent de créer, de mettre à jour et de supprimer des abonnements et des rubriques Event Grid. Voici les Kits SDK actuellement disponibles :
Kit SDK | Package | Documentation de référence | Exemples |
---|---|---|---|
API REST | Référence REST | ||
.NET | Azure.ResourceManager.EventGrid . Le package a la dernière Namespaces API. |
Référence .NET : préversion, disponibilité générale | Exemples relatifs à .NET |
Java | azure-resourcemanager-eventgrid . Le package a la dernière Namespaces API. |
Référence Java : préversion, disponibilité générale | Exemples relatifs à Java |
JavaScript | @azure/arm-eventgrid . Le package a la dernière Namespaces API. |
Référence JavaScript : préversion, disponibilité générale | Exemples JavaScript et TypeScript |
Python | azure-mgmt-eventgrid . Le package a la dernière Namespaces API. |
Référence Python : préversion, disponibilité générale | Exemples Python |
Go | Kit de développement logiciel (SDK) Azure pour Go | Exemples Go |
Kits SDK de plan de données
Notes
Pour la messagerie MQTT, vous pouvez utiliser votre kit de développement logiciel (SDK) MQTT favori. Actuellement, Azure Event Grid ne fournit pas de kit de développement logiciel (SDK) de plan de données pour MQTT.
Les kits SDK de plan de données permettent de publier des événements sur des rubriques tout en gérant l’authentification, la formation de l’événement et la publication asynchrone sur le point de terminaison spécifié. Ils vous permettent également de consommer des événements internes. Voici les Kits SDK actuellement disponibles :
Langage de programmation | Package | Documentation de référence | Exemples |
---|---|---|---|
API REST | Référence REST | ||
.NET | Azure.Messaging.EventGrid . Le package a la dernière Namespaces API. |
Information de référence sur .NET | Exemples relatifs à .NET |
Java | azure-messaging-eventgrid . Le package a la dernière Namespaces API. |
Référence Java | Exemples relatifs à Java |
JavaScript | @azure/eventgrid . Le package a la dernière Namespaces API. |
Référence JavaScript | Exemples JavaScript et TypeScript |
Python | azure-eventgrid . Le package a la dernière Namespaces API. |
Référence Python | Exemples Python |
Go | Kit de développement logiciel (SDK) Azure pour Go |
Étapes suivantes
- Pour obtenir des exemples d’application, consultez la page Exemples de code Event Grid.
- Pour une présentation d’Event Grid, consultez l’article What is Event Grid? (Présentation d’Event Grid).
- Pour connaître les commandes Event Grid dans Azure CLI, consultez la section Azure CLI.
- Pour connaître les commandes Event Grid dans PowerShell, consultez la section PowerShell.